Output 3ad8a34e8826cbc06a9a0e6d29e3165f56686de976d457a3be3dbc994c415727:17

value
14500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c1420349b4870a7cec4c29d92ae99795b803cf OP_EQUAL
address
9thAPnWFSDhZo8tchrFEvx9YEj326emafe
transaction
3ad8a34e8826cbc06a9a0e6d29e3165f56686de976d457a3be3dbc994c415727